Apple and cheese cake without bottom

Time

Preparation time: 25 min.
Cooking or baking time: 35 min.
Total preparation time: 60 min.

I have this fruity-delicious apple and cheese cake in a modification of the recipe? Rhubarb cheese cake without bottom? baked by Upsi in 2017. Not only did I replace the rhubarb with apples, I also changed other ingredients and quantities a bit. The result - a nice variant for a fruity cheesecake after the rhubarb season, not only for apple fans!

Ingredients for a 28 cm springform

  • about 600 g of apples
  • 3 eggs
  • 150 g of sugar
  • 1 pck of vanilla sugar
  • 750 g quark
  • 250 ml buttermilk
  • 1 pck of vanilla pudding powder
  • 40 g semolina
  • 1 teaspoon Baking powder
  • Juice of ½ lemon

preparation

  1. The oven is preheated to 170 degrees circulating air.
  2. The apples are washed, quartered, freed from the core and cut into small pieces, one or two of them in narrow columns and drizzled with a little lemon juice. If you want, you can peel the apples, but that's not really necessary.
  3. For the dough, the eggs are beaten with sugar and vanilla sugar in a mixing bowl with the hand mixer creamy.
  4. Then you gradually add the other ingredients and stir everything well.
  5. Finally, the apple pieces are carefully lifted.
  6. Now fill the batter into the greased mold, smooth the surface and spread the apple slices over it.
  7. Bake is then about 30-35 minutes on the middle grid in the preheated oven.

(I baked the cake for 40 minutes, which made the surface a bit too dark.)
